Enforcement action by district councils6

1

It shall be the duty of every district council—

a

to consider, at least once in every period of 12 months, the extent to which it is appropriate for the council to carry out in its district a programme of enforcement action relating to Part II of the Health and Personal Social Services (Northern Ireland) Order 1978 and Articles 3 and 4, and

b

accordingly to carry out in its district any programme which is for the time being considered by the council to be appropriate under sub-paragraph (a).

2

In paragraph (1)(a) the reference to a programme of enforcement action relating to the provisions there mentioned is a reference to a programme involving all or any of the following, namely—

a

the bringing of prosecutions in respect of offences under those provisions;

b

the investigation of complaints in respect of alleged offences under those provisions;

c

the taking of other measures intended to reduce the incidence of offences under those provisions;

d

the making of complaints under Article 4(1) of the Order of 1978 and, with a view to determining whether such complaints should be made, the monitoring of the use of such machines for the sale of tobacco as are mentioned in that provision.
